Core Rules
1. Always Wait Before Acting
Never click or type immediately after navigation. Always wait for the element:
await page.waitForSelector('#button');
await page.click('#button');
Clicking without waiting causes "element not found" errors 90% of the time.
2. Use Specific Selectors
Prefer stable selectors in this order:
[data-testid="submit"] โ test attributes (most stable)
#unique-id โ IDs
form button[type="submit"] โ semantic combinations
.class-name โ classes (least stable, changes often)
Avoid: div > div > div > button โ breaks on any DOM change.
3. Handle Navigation Explicitly
After clicks that navigate, wait for navigation:
await Promise.all([
page.waitForNavigation(),
page.click('a.next-page')
]);
Without this, the script continues before the new page loads.
4. Set Realistic Viewport
Always set viewport for consistent rendering:
await page.setViewport({ width: 1280, height: 800 });
Default viewport is 800x600 โ many sites render differently or show mobile views.
5. Handle Popups and Dialogs
Dismiss dialogs before they block interaction:
page.on('dialog', async dialog => {
await dialog.dismiss();
});
Unhandled dialogs freeze the script.
6. Close Browser on Errors
Always wrap in try/finally:
const browser = await puppeteer.launch();
try {
} finally {
await browser.close();
}
Leaked browser processes consume memory and ports.
7. Respect Rate Limits
Add delays between requests to avoid blocks:
await page.waitForTimeout(1000 + Math.random() * 2000);
Hammering sites triggers CAPTCHAs and IP bans.
Common Traps
page.click() on invisible element โ fails silently, use waitForSelector with visible: true
- Screenshots of elements off-screen โ blank image, scroll into view first
page.evaluate() returns undefined โ cannot return DOM nodes, only serializable data
- Headless blocked by site โ use
headless: 'new' or set user agent
- Form submit reloads page โ
page.waitForNavigation() or data is lost
- Shadow DOM elements invisible to selectors โ use
page.evaluateHandle() to pierce shadow roots
- Cookies not persisting โ launch with
userDataDir for session persistence
